Output 66ea20af7883a778958d5f3538bc78dbe2e0dfdb8d818b7a967490425820d14a:0

value
1020448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a609af29040f6668c16070e975488528625c828 OP_EQUAL
address
MLWqD9tverg2s74ZnHRQsLjDCfgp7qh6ag
transaction
66ea20af7883a778958d5f3538bc78dbe2e0dfdb8d818b7a967490425820d14a
spent
true